TAMPA, Fla. – By all accounts, Yankees players were stunned to learn that their manager was admitted to a local hospital Wednesday, awaiting surgery for a pacemaker. And they were touched that Aaron Boone thought to send them a message via video. The Yankees said Boone, 47, has undergone surgery on Wednesday in Tampa, Fla., where he is overseeing the team’s spring training ahead of the 2021 season. The new name is expected to be in place by the time students return … TAMPA — Aaron Boone went back to work Saturday, just three days after having a pacemaker inserted to address a low heart rate. New York Yankees manager and one-time MLB All-Star Aaron Boone had his playing career cut a bit short due to issues with his heart and it’s now also affecting his coaching career as it was announced on Wednesday that he’ll be taking a medical leave of absence to have a pacemaker put in because of a low heart rate. As Brett Gardner said, the players initial thoughts were of Boone’s well-being, while “his first thoughts (were about) us and our well-being and making sure we feel at ease with what’s going on.’’. While pacemakers are commonly used to calibrate heart rates, what makes Boone's case unusual is his age: He turns 48 on Tuesday. All rights reserved. Boone’s pacemaker is to keep his heart rate from dropping below 50-60 beats per minute or from rising too high.
